How to go beyond “click here”?

First of all, you need to understand the importance of investing in optimizing your CTAs. After all, thinking about more attractive calls for attention goes beyond understanding your persona. It is also a very important resource for ranking the content you produce.

By the way, did you know that the Google prioritizes more descriptive CTAs?

That's right, you need to make it clear what your intention is with a given link, describing the function of that resource.

To do this, you can either make it more attractive, geared towards your persona's tastes, or describe where it will take your visitor.

This makes it easier for Google to map your website, which places your content in higher positions in the search platform's rankings.

1. Be specific and descriptive

As I had already commented and, in fact, indicated in the title of this article, go beyond the terms “click here” and “find out more”.

You need to keep in mind that your user will want more information to actually click on a button or link.

For example, in an online clothing store, talking about a specific item and adding a “learn more” button below may not be enough. Therefore, tell the user what they will find when they click the button.

Whether it's the price of the product, or a button that directs the customer to the checkout page, make the action that will be taken clear.

And this can be applied to countless situations, such as:

  • “Receive your e-book here”;
  • “Click here and download your infographic”;
  • “Fill out this form”
  • Among many other scenarios.

2. Use impactful calling

Use mental triggers to optimize CTA, focus on your persona’s pains and desires and create impactful calls.

To achieve this, using numbers, urgency, exclusivity and other resources can be essential to attract the user’s attention.

Furthermore, it can help your campaign and make your material more attractive.

  • “Click and get 10% discount”;
  • "Buy now";
  • “Request a quote right now”;
  • Among others.

3. Use buttons, images and links

Before we continue, it is necessary to emphasize that the Call to Action is not just about buttons. Therefore, explore other resources on your page such as links throughout the copy and images that are attractive to your persona.

Thus, easily directing your visitor to the page you want them to see.

This way, you end up making the layout of CTAs more diverse, a fact that contributes to the readability of your content.

Furthermore, some of the resources, such as images, can make your CTA more attractive and descriptive, increasing the chances of getting more clicks.
